TM 55-6695-220-13&P (2)   Connect the eight ohm resistance standard to the thermocouple lead clips. (3)   Set the LEAD RESISTANCE SWITCH to the 8 OHM position. (4)   Rotate the LEAD RESISTANCE CONTROL of the null-balance galvanometer circuit back and forth to bring the VOLTMETER pointer over the zero mark. NOTE The Decade Resistance Box may be used as a resistance standard, but first each test value must be determined to an accuracy of ±0.002 ohm using the Digital Multi-meter. (5)   Depress the METER SENSITIVITY button to increase the circuit sensitivity and continue to adjust the LEAD RESISTANCE CONTROL for a null condition.  The error indicated by the LEAD RESISTANCE CONTROL shall not differ from the resistance standard value by more than ±0.02 ohm. (6)   Repeat steps 1 through 5 for resistance standard values of 2 and 22 ohms, each time returning the LEAD RESISTANCE CONTROL to the OFF position before changing resistors. 3-10
